Eerie Von

Eerie Von

Born on 08/25/1964, Eerie grew up in Lodi, NJ and graduated from Lodi High School in 1982 with Steve Zing and Doyle of The Misfits. Before joining Samhain, Eerie played drums for the Lodi band Rosemary's Babies. He also was a roadie and photographer for The Misfits. Originally in Samhain as the drummer, Eerie later switched to bass to take advantage of his potential as a stage presence, replacing Al Pike. When the band changed its name to Danzig, Eerie remained, playing on the first 4 Danzig albums, and developing a close relationship with the band's fans. After Eerie and John Christ left the band in July 1995, he later formed Bighouse, and recorded solo albums, one with Mike Morance.

Equipment:
1984 - 1987: Fender Jazz bass, ESP Jazz bass, Aria Pro bass, Peavey amplifier, Peavey Black Widow cabinets (15" speakers), ProCo Rat distortion pedal, D'Addario Round Wound strings.
1987 - now: Fender Jazz bass, SVT amplifiers, Ampeg cabinets (eight 10" speakers per cabinet), D'Addario Round Wound strings.
